1
0
mirror of https://github.com/google/comprehensive-rust.git synced 2025-03-22 14:59:37 +02:00

Ensure code blocks are editable (#597)

We should default to making code blocks editable: this ensures
consistent syntax highlighting (see #343) and it allows the instructor
to freely edit anything they want.
This commit is contained in:
Martin Geisler 2023-04-27 14:45:41 -07:00 committed by GitHub
parent 5074b1751c
commit 6ade739651
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
4 changed files with 4 additions and 4 deletions

View File

@ -2,7 +2,7 @@
By default, a panic will cause the stack to unwind. The unwinding can be caught:
```rust
```rust,editable
use std::panic;
let result = panic::catch_unwind(|| {

View File

@ -3,7 +3,7 @@
We have already seen the `Result` enum. This is used pervasively when errors are
expected as part of normal operation:
```rust
```rust,editable
use std::fs::File;
use std::io::Read;

View File

@ -3,7 +3,7 @@
Let us jump into the simplest possible Rust program, a classic Hello World
program:
```rust
```rust,editable
fn main() {
println!("Hello 🌍!");
}

View File

@ -2,7 +2,7 @@
Mark unit tests with `#[test]`:
```rust,ignore
```rust,editable,ignore
fn first_word(text: &str) -> &str {
match text.find(' ') {
Some(idx) => &text[..idx],